If you haven't looked for a bathroom in recent times, you're in for a shock. Warmed and LED-lit seats, built-in bidet functionality, and water-saving and self-cleaning features are simply a few of the high-tech alternatives you'll require to assess. Most likely to map-testing. com to check any type of commode's capability to finish the job with just one push of the manage. Look for bathrooms with a Maximum Performance (MaP) testing score of 500 or greater.

Bathroom dimension and budget are 2 leading factors to consider when developing and renovating a restroom. These considerations will certainly influence what materials to get and just how much, and it can also determine what parts of the washroom to prioritize and which to put on the back burner. Other things to consider consist of ease of access for your household and visitors, color pattern, and functionality.

Begin tiling wall surfaces first, if you intend to have actually tiled wall surfaces, prior to proceeding to floors. Caulk around the space, especially where ceramic tile satisfies the tub, toilet, and vanity top, after tiling for much better protection versus wetness.
